A condominium association decided to set up a sinking fund to accumulate $50,000 by the end of 4 years to build a new sauna and swimming pool. What quarterly deposits are required if the annual interest rate is 4.6% and it is compounded quarterly?
Answer provided by our tutors
S = $50,000 is the future value
r = 4.6% = 0.046 yearly interest rate
i = r/12 = 0.046/4 interest rate per quarter
n = 4*4 = 16 number of payment periods
R = the quarter payment quarterly deposits)
S = R[((1 + i)^n - 1)/i]
R = Si/((1 + i)^n - 1)
R = (50000*0.046/4)/(((1 + 0.046/4)^(16)) - 1)
